Searched refs:EltBits (Results 1 – 10 of 10) sorted by relevance
/external/llvm/include/llvm/IR/ |
D | DerivedTypes.h | 375 unsigned EltBits = VTy->getElementType()->getPrimitiveSizeInBits(); in getInteger() local 376 assert(EltBits && "Element size must be of a non-zero size"); in getInteger() 377 Type *EltTy = IntegerType::get(VTy->getContext(), EltBits); in getInteger() 386 unsigned EltBits = VTy->getElementType()->getPrimitiveSizeInBits(); in getExtendedElementVectorType() local 387 Type *EltTy = IntegerType::get(VTy->getContext(), EltBits * 2); in getExtendedElementVectorType() 396 unsigned EltBits = VTy->getElementType()->getPrimitiveSizeInBits(); in getTruncatedElementVectorType() local 397 assert((EltBits & 1) == 0 && in getTruncatedElementVectorType() 399 Type *EltTy = IntegerType::get(VTy->getContext(), EltBits / 2); in getTruncatedElementVectorType()
|
/external/llvm/lib/Target/ARM/MCTargetDesc/ |
D | ARMAddressingModes.h | 541 static inline uint64_t decodeNEONModImm(unsigned ModImm, unsigned &EltBits) { in decodeNEONModImm() argument 549 EltBits = 8; in decodeNEONModImm() 554 EltBits = 16; in decodeNEONModImm() 559 EltBits = 32; in decodeNEONModImm() 564 EltBits = 32; in decodeNEONModImm() 571 EltBits = 64; in decodeNEONModImm()
|
/external/llvm/lib/Target/AArch64/Utils/ |
D | AArch64BaseInfo.cpp | 1145 unsigned &EltBits) { in decodeNeonModImm() argument 1147 EltBits = 0; in decodeNeonModImm() 1151 EltBits = 8; in decodeNeonModImm() 1159 EltBits = 64; in decodeNeonModImm() 1162 EltBits = 16; in decodeNeonModImm() 1165 EltBits = 32; in decodeNeonModImm() 1168 EltBits = 32; in decodeNeonModImm()
|
D | AArch64BaseInfo.h | 1072 uint64_t decodeNeonModImm(unsigned Val, unsigned OpCmode, unsigned &EltBits);
|
/external/llvm/lib/Target/ARM/InstPrinter/ |
D | ARMInstPrinter.cpp | 1226 unsigned EltBits; in printNEONModImmOperand() local 1227 uint64_t Val = ARM_AM::decodeNEONModImm(EncodedImm, EltBits); in printNEONModImmOperand()
|
/external/clang/lib/CodeGen/ |
D | CGBuiltin.cpp | 2487 unsigned EltBits = VTy->getElementType()->getPrimitiveSizeInBits(); in EmitARMBuiltinExpr() local 2489 llvm::IntegerType::get(getLLVMContext(), EltBits / 2); in EmitARMBuiltinExpr() 2502 unsigned EltBits = VTy->getElementType()->getPrimitiveSizeInBits(); in EmitARMBuiltinExpr() local 2503 llvm::Type *EltTy = llvm::IntegerType::get(getLLVMContext(), EltBits / 2); in EmitARMBuiltinExpr()
|
/external/llvm/lib/Target/AArch64/ |
D | AArch64InstrNEON.td | 324 unsigned EltBits; 326 OpCmodeConstVal->getZExtValue(), EltBits); 327 return (EltBits == 8 && EltVal == 0xff);
|
/external/llvm/lib/Target/ARM/ |
D | ARMInstrNEON.td | 549 unsigned EltBits = 0; 550 uint64_t EltVal = ARM_AM::decodeNEONModImm(ConstVal->getZExtValue(), EltBits); 551 return (EltBits == 32 && EltVal == 0); 556 unsigned EltBits = 0; 557 uint64_t EltVal = ARM_AM::decodeNEONModImm(ConstVal->getZExtValue(), EltBits); 558 return (EltBits == 8 && EltVal == 0xff);
|
D | ARMISelLowering.cpp | 9248 unsigned EltBits; in PerformVDUPLANECombine() local 9249 if (ARM_AM::decodeNEONModImm(Imm, EltBits) == 0) in PerformVDUPLANECombine()
|
/external/llvm/lib/Target/X86/ |
D | X86ISelLowering.cpp | 17101 unsigned EltBits = MaskVT.getVectorElementType().getSizeInBits(); in PerformOrCombine() local 17114 if ((SraAmt + 1) != EltBits) in PerformOrCombine() 17125 assert((EltBits == 8 || EltBits == 16 || EltBits == 32) && in PerformOrCombine()
|